> Hi
>
> Hoping someone can help me. I'd like to open a URL in Safari and submit some post params at the same time. I can achieve the end result quite easily using Safari's `do JavaScript` functionality:
>
> tell application "Safari"
> activate
> tell window 1 to set current tab to make new tab
> do JavaScript "location = 'https://www.somwhere.net/';
> onload = function() {
> document.forms[0].item1.value = 'fred';
> document.forms[0].item2.value = 'bert';
> document.forms[0].submit();
> }" in document 1
> end tell
>
> But being an impatient blighter I find that waiting for the the first page to load is a waste of time. Why not go straight to the page I want, submitting the post parameters as I go - but I can't find the syntax.
>
> TIA for an pointers.
